Cognac Brown is a rich, warm shade inspired by the tones of aged cognac liquor. This color evokes heritage, craftsmanship, and classic luxury. It is a mid-to-dark brown with orange and red undertones, giving it a golden glow. Unlike dark espresso browns or blackened umbers, Cognac Brown retains a natural warmth that makes spaces feel inviting rather than heavy.

Best Design Styles for Cognac Brown Sofas

Cognac Brown is flexible and integrates well into various design aesthetics. Here’s how it fits within different styles:

  • Modern Industrial: The warm tone pairs well with exposed brick, black metal frames, and reclaimed wood. It softens the raw, edgy aesthetic of industrial interiors while adding contrast.
  • Mid-Century Modern: This style thrives on warm wood tones and minimalist designs. A Cognac Brown leather sofa complements walnut furniture and brass accents.
  • Rustic & Farmhouse: Earthy tones dominate rustic interiors, and this sofa shade blends seamlessly with distressed wood, wool textiles, and soft neutral palettes like beige and ivory.
  • Contemporary Chic: For a polished, modern look, Cognac Brown pairs well with blacks, grays, and muted blues. A minimalist approach with clean lines enhances its elegance.
  • Bohemian & Eclectic: If you prefer an artistic, layered look, Cognac Brown serves as a grounding neutral amid vibrant textiles, colorful rugs, and unique patterns.

Best Color Combinations with Cognac Brown

To highlight the beauty of Cognac Brown leather, it’s essential to choose complementary colors in the room. Here are a few foolproof combinations:

  • Neutral Palette (Beige, Ivory, and Taupe): These shades allow the warm brown to shine while maintaining a soft, serene atmosphere.
  • Deep Greens and Blues: A rich forest green or navy blue creates a sophisticated contrast with Cognac Brown, adding elegance and depth.
  • Black and Charcoal: For a bold, modern edge, pairing Cognac Brown with black elements results in a high-contrast, dramatic look.
  • Burnt Orange and Mustard Yellow: These analogous colors enhance the sofa’s warmth and create a cozy, inviting space.

How to Care for Cognac Brown Leather

Leather is durable, but proper care ensures it remains stunning for years. Here are some maintenance tips for keeping a Cognac Brown leather sofa in top condition:

  1. Regular Cleaning – Wipe with a dry or slightly damp microfiber cloth to remove dust and prevent buildup.
  2. Conditioning – Use a high-quality leather conditioner every few months to maintain suppleness and prevent cracking.
  3. Avoid Direct Sunlight – Too much exposure can cause fading. Position the sofa away from direct sunlight or use curtains to diffuse light.
  4. Handle Spills Promptly – Blot (not rub) spills with a soft cloth, and avoid harsh chemical cleaners that strip the leather’s natural oils.
